@charset "utf-8";



.container{position:relative;width:100%;max-width:1920px;min-width:1200px;margin:0 auto; }
.icon{ display: inline-block; background: url(/template/001/cn/image/v1.3/sp-ico.png) no-repeat; vertical-align: middle}
.inner{width:1200px; margin: 0 auto;}

.top-bar{width:100%;height:31px;background: #f7f7f7;border-bottom: 1px solid #eeeeee; }
.top-bar a{ font-size: 14px;color: #8e8e8e; line-height: 31px;}
.top-bar .fr a{ display: inline-block; margin-left: 20px;}
.top-bar .icon-home{width:15px; height:15px; background-position: 0 0; margin-right: 5px;}
.top-bar .icon-login{width:15px; height:15px; background-position: -24px 0;}
.top-bar .icon-email{width:15px; height:15px; background-position: -47px 0; margin-right: 5px;}

.logo{width:100%;height:110px;background:#fff}
.logo .lg{display:inline-block}
.logo .code{padding:7px 20px;border:1px solid #e8e8e8;font-size:12px;color:#666;margin:34px 0 0 40px}
.logo .tag{width:400px;margin-top:30px}
.logo .tag span{display:inline-block;font-size:16px;color:#29a7e2;line-height:28px;margin-left:20px}

.nav{width:100%;height:44px;background:#29a7e2}
.nav li{display:block;float:left;line-height:44px;text-align:center;font-size:14px;position:relative}
.nav li em{background:url(/template/001/cn/image/v1.3/sp-ico.png) no-repeat 100% 0;vertical-align:middle;width:1px;height:15px;display:block;position:absolute;top:15px;right:0}
.nav li a{color:#fff;display:inline-block;padding:0 35px}
.nav li.active,.nav li:hover{color:#fff;background:#2298d1}
